I think overeating on-Plan foods was my problem as well. I have a large salad everyday for lunch and was putting way too much cheese and nuts on it. Then I was snacking before dinner on things like pork rinds or creamed coconut and also having second helpings for dinner and often a homemade coconut cocoa ice pop in the evening.

Being back on induction I am reminded how hard it is to stay under 20 carbs! Just adding up my allotted tbls. of cream, 3 oz. cheese, salad greens, .6 for each egg, my one cup of cooked broccoli and the like for dinner, I am often slightly over for the day and feel like I have barely eaten anything. I'm also trying to stay below 1500 cal.
Despite that, I seem to be controlling hunger more easily, with no more snacks. I was obviously eating way too many carbs before, and driving my appetite high. It's amazing how little food I really need to feel good.
I have lost 4 lbs. in 2 weeks. I'm going to continue with induction till I get down to 120 and then add in one food - cocoa in my coffee - and see if I can control things a little better.
